NOTE: Do not complete a Home Health Agency application
if the intent is to provide only personal care services that
include assistance with activities of daily living, housekeeping activities,
and/or accompanying client to medical appointments.

HOME HEALTH AGENCY: An organization that
provides part-time and intermittent skilled nursing and other therapeutic services on a
visiting basis to persons in their homes.
The
home health agency shall directly provide or arrange for at least part-time
or intermittent nursing services and provide or arrange for home health aide
services.
